Vehicle Diagnostics: Keeping Tabs on Performance

One of the key components of predictive maintenance is vehicle diagnostics. Through the use of sophisticated software, automotive companies can now monitor various aspects of a vehicle’s performance in real-time. From tracking engine temperature to monitoring tire pressure, these diagnostics tools provide valuable data that can help in predicting potential issues before they escalate.

Predictive Analytics: Analyzing Data Patterns

Another crucial aspect of automotive software in predictive maintenance is predictive analytics. By analyzing data patterns from vehicle diagnostics and other sources, software can predict when a particular component is likely to fail. This proactive approach allows automotive companies to schedule maintenance tasks ahead of time, thus reducing the risk of unexpected breakdowns.

Remote Monitoring: Accessing Real-Time Data

With the advent of automotive software, remote monitoring has become a reality. Automotive companies can now access real-time data from vehicles on the road, allowing them to proactively address any issues that may arise. Whether it’s a drop in oil pressure or a malfunctioning sensor, remote monitoring enables automotive companies to take prompt action and ensure the safety and reliability of their vehicles.

1. What is predictive maintenance?
Predictive maintenance is a proactive approach to maintenance that uses advanced software and data analytics to predict when a particular component is likely to fail. By analyzing data patterns and monitoring vehicle performance in real-time, automotive companies can schedule maintenance tasks ahead of time, thus preventing unexpected breakdowns.
